股票k线图用的是什么编程软件

不及物动词 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    股票K线图常用的编程软件有多种,以下是其中几种常见的:

    1. Python:Python是一种广泛使用的编程语言,它有丰富的第三方库和工具,适合进行数据分析和可视化。Python中常用的绘图库有Matplotlib、Seaborn和Plotly,可以使用这些库来绘制股票K线图。

    2. R语言:R语言也是一种常用于数据分析和可视化的编程语言,拥有丰富的统计分析和绘图功能。在R语言中,可以使用ggplot2包或其他相关包来绘制股票K线图。

    3. JavaScript:JavaScript是一种广泛用于Web开发的编程语言,可以使用其相关库和框架来实现股票K线图的绘制。常用的库有D3.js、Highcharts和ECharts,它们提供了丰富的图形绘制功能和交互性。

    4. Excel:Excel也是一种常用的绘图工具,可以使用其内置的功能来绘制简单的股票K线图。通过使用Excel的公式和图表功能,可以实现一些基本的数据可视化。

    需要注意的是,以上提到的编程软件都有其各自的特点和适用场景,选择哪种编程软件主要取决于个人的需求、熟练程度和工作环境。同时,还可以根据具体的需求考虑其他编程软件或工具,以便更好地绘制股票K线图。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    股票K线图一般使用以下编程软件:

    1. Python:Python是一种非常流行的编程语言,它具有广泛的应用领域,包括数据分析和可视化。Python中有许多强大的库和工具,如Matplotlib和Seaborn,可以用于绘制K线图。

    2. R语言:R语言是一种用于统计计算和数据可视化的编程语言。它有许多用于绘制图表的包,如ggplot2和plotly,可以用于生成K线图。

    3. JavaScript:JavaScript是一种用于Web开发的脚本语言,可以用于在网页上创建交互式K线图。常用的库包括D3.js和Highcharts.js。

    4. Java:Java是一种广泛应用于企业级应用程序开发的编程语言。Java有一些库,如JFreeChart和ChartFX,可以用于生成K线图。

    5. C++:C++是一种高性能的编程语言,广泛应用于金融领域。C++有一些库,如Qt和Boost,可以用于绘制K线图。

    需要注意的是,以上列举的编程软件只是其中的一部分,实际上还有很多其他编程软件也可以用于绘制K线图,选择使用哪种编程软件取决于个人的偏好和项目需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    股票K线图是通过编程软件来实现的,常用的编程软件包括Python、R、Matlab等。下面将以Python为例,介绍如何使用Python编程软件绘制股票K线图。

    1. 数据获取和准备
      首先,需要获取股票的历史交易数据。可以使用股票数据接口,如tushare、baostock等,或者通过其他途径获取股票数据,并将数据存储为CSV或Excel格式。确保数据包含日期、开盘价、最高价、最低价、收盘价等必要字段。

    2. 导入库
      在Python程序中,需要导入相应的库来实现绘制K线图的功能。常用的库包括pandas、matplotlib、mplfinance等。可以使用pip命令安装所需的库。

    3. 加载数据
      使用pandas库的read_csv()函数或read_excel()函数加载股票数据文件,并将数据存储为DataFrame格式。

    4. 数据处理
      在绘制K线图之前,需要对数据进行一些处理。可以使用pandas库的一些函数,如shift()函数计算涨跌幅、rolling()函数计算移动平均线等。

    5. 绘制K线图
      使用mplfinance库中的plot()函数来绘制K线图。该函数提供了丰富的参数,可以设置K线图的样式、指标线等。可以通过设置参数来自定义K线图的外观。

    6. 添加指标线
      在K线图上添加一些技术指标线,如移动平均线、成交量等。可以使用mplfinance库的add_subplot()函数来添加子图,并在子图上绘制指标线。

    7. 标注重要事件
      可以使用mplfinance库的annotate()函数来标注K线图上的重要事件,如买入信号、卖出信号等。

    8. 图表设置和保存
      最后,可以设置图表的标题、坐标轴标签等,调整图表的大小和颜色,然后保存图表为图片或PDF格式。

    以上是使用Python编程软件绘制股票K线图的基本流程。具体的实现方式和细节可以根据实际需求进行调整和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部